[Résolu] Nombre de décimales d'un champ "décimal"

Discussions sur le module de base de données Base et plus particulièrement sur le langage SQL ou sur les connexions aux SGBD tiers.
Les questions sur les macros doivent être postées dans la section dédiée en dessous.

Modérateur: Vilains modOOs

Règles du forum
Cette section est dédiée au module Base et plus particulièrement sur le langage SQL ou sur les connexions aux SGBD tiers. Vous ne devez pas poster ici de questions sur les macros mais utiliser la section éponyme.
Pour accélérer les réponses, vous pouvez mettre en ligne votre base en joignant un fichier ODB : comment faire.

[Résolu] Nombre de décimales d'un champ "décimal"

Messagepar Ribiere » 31 Déc 2017 19:06

Bonjour ,

L'année se termine comme elle a commencé par une bêtise de ma part .
J'ai créé une dizaine de tables avec des champs "décimaux" , mais j'ai oublié de préciser le nombre de décimale .....
J'ai ensuite utilisé ces tables dans des requêtes , des vues et des formulaires .....
Lorsque j'essaye de corriger le paramétrage des champs concernés , je ne peux plus le faire : message d'erreur , "la tables est utilisée ....etc ....
A part me donner des coups de pieds au derrière ( c'est pas facile , mais je devrais y arriver ..), que puis je faire pour corriger ma bourde ?

Merci de vos propositions D.R
Dernière édition par Ribiere le 01 Jan 2018 18:41, édité 1 fois.
Libre office 6 sous windows 10
Ribiere
Membre OOrganisé
Membre OOrganisé
 
Message(s) : 78
Inscrit le : 20 Août 2014 22:51

Re: Nb de décimale d'un champs "décimal"

Messagepar jeanmimi » 01 Jan 2018 10:16

Bonjour,
En général, lorsqu'on veut modifier un champ d'une Table, et que ça coince, il peut être plus facile d'aller dans l'interface des Relations puis de supprimer les relations entre les champs des différentes Tables, sauvegarder, et retourner dans les Tables à modifier.
Il restera ensuite à remettre les liens entres les champs.
LibreOffice Version: 6.1.2.1 (x64) (28 septembre 2018)
Java (x64) 1.8.0_xxx, Windows 10, Thunderbird, Firefox
Avatar de l’utilisateur
jeanmimi
Grand Maître de l'OOffice
Grand Maître de l'OOffice
 
Message(s) : 14527
Inscrit le : 03 Mars 2006 17:02
Localisation : Niort et sa Venise verte

Re: Nb de décimale d'un champs "décimal"

Messagepar Ribiere » 01 Jan 2018 16:58

Bonjour ,

Merci pour cette réponse un premier janvier ....je ne m'y attendais pas ... en plus d'être performants vous êtes dispo +++

Si le monde pouvait vous ressembler ...

J'essaye dès ce soir la solution proposée , merci encore , je vous mets le résultat après le travail .

D.R

Re- bonjour ,

Je n'ai pas résisté jusqu'à ce soir , j'ai essayé sauf que je définis les relations entre tables à chaque vue ou requête car j'ai du mal à définir des relations par l'onglet "outils"=>"relation" et que donc , je n'ai rien dans cet onglet... c'est plus simple pour moi au fil de la conception de mon travail , mais je me pénalise par la suite ... dur dur , mais c'est ainsi que j'apprends : je n'avais jamais compris à quoi servait cet onglet , maintenant je sais ...

Merci tout de même de la proposition de solution , je ferme le fil, D.R
Libre office 6 sous windows 10
Ribiere
Membre OOrganisé
Membre OOrganisé
 
Message(s) : 78
Inscrit le : 20 Août 2014 22:51

Re: [Résolu]Nb de décimale d'un champs "décimal"

Messagepar jeanmimi » 02 Jan 2018 09:05

L'onglet Relations présente en premier l'avantage de pourvoir tester la validité des liens entre des champs de différentes Tables.
Ensuite, les liens établis sont reconnus par l'Assistant de Base, ce qui se traduit par la proposition des Tables pour les sous-formulaires lors de la création d'un formulaire. Enfin, les liens entre des champs s'ajustent automatiquement lors de la création des requêtes.
LibreOffice Version: 6.1.2.1 (x64) (28 septembre 2018)
Java (x64) 1.8.0_xxx, Windows 10, Thunderbird, Firefox
Avatar de l’utilisateur
jeanmimi
Grand Maître de l'OOffice
Grand Maître de l'OOffice
 
Message(s) : 14527
Inscrit le : 03 Mars 2006 17:02
Localisation : Niort et sa Venise verte

Re: [Résolu]Nb de décimale d'un champs "décimal"

Messagepar Ribiere » 02 Jan 2018 10:37

Bonjour ,

Merci pour les précisions apportées :il ne me reste plus qu'à forcer ma flemme , pour utiliser au mieux l'outil qui nous est proposé .
Je le trouve de plus en plus génial au fur et à mesure que je l'utilise .
J'ai bientôt 70 ans , quel dommage que je ne l'ai pas eu à ma disposition lorsque j'étais jeune ....mais il n'est jamais trop tard , il ne reste qu'à rajeunir ( si l'un de vous a une proposition .... )

Que la future année vous soit douce te agréable , D.R
Libre office 6 sous windows 10
Ribiere
Membre OOrganisé
Membre OOrganisé
 
Message(s) : 78
Inscrit le : 20 Août 2014 22:51


Retour vers Base de données

Qui est en ligne ?

Utilisateur(s) parcourant ce forum : Google [Bot] et 4 invité(s)